Important: Candidate Endorsements

JCRs and MCRs are not permitted to endorse candidates in the SU Leadership Elections.

This means JCRs/MCRs cannot:

  • Publicly support or promote a specific candidate

  • Use official channels to encourage voting for a particular person

  • Share endorsements on behalf of the committee
     

You can, however:

  • Encourage students to vote

  • Promote election dates and information

  • Share official SU elections content

Polling Cards

Every student will receive a polling card in their pigeon hole with details on:

  • When voting opens and closes

  • How to vote

  • What positions are being elected
